2010-06-09 13 views
2

J'utilise EnableCdn = true dans mon ScriptManager pour que WebResource.axd et ScriptResource.axd soient remplacés par des liens statiques aux bibliothèques JS au service MS CDN comme suit:ASP .NET 4.0 Comment rediriger/remplacer le chemin d'accès CDN par défaut pour ScriptManager lorsque EnableCDN = true

<asp:ScriptManager ID="ScriptManager1" runat="server" EnableCdn="true" /> 

Comment remplacer l'URL CDN ou un service afin que je puisse récupérer les scripts via HTTPS à partir du service MS CDN plutôt que HTTP pour éviter le mode mixte navigateur message? ou d'ailleurs un service CDN différent ou mon propre entièrement.

Répondre

0

Maintenant, il y a une nouvelle propriété sur WebResourceAttribute: CdnPath:

[assembly: WebResource("Foo.js", "application/x-javascript", 
    CdnPath = "http://foo.com/foo/bar/foo.js")] 

More info here.

+0

Je suis désireux de le faire dans le monde une fois et non sur un scénario par script et je me bats avec où/comment le faire. – plattnum